Cherry-packed Recipes

  1. Redness Relief Cherry Face Mask:
    • 5 mashed cherries
    • 1 teaspoon organic honey
    • 3 drops of lemon juice

    Mix, apply, and let it work its magic for 15-20 minutes. Rinse off with warm water. Ah, sweet relief!

  2. Youthful Glow Berry Mask:

  3. Cherries ‘n Cream Exfoliating Scrub:
    • 5 mashed cherries
    • 2-3 tablespoons plain yogurt
    • 3 tablespoons coarse sugar

    Gently scrub in circular motions, rinse off with warm water, and revel in the smoothness!

  4. Cherry Oatmeal Mask:
    • 1 tablespoon instant oatmeal
    • 2 tablespoons cherry juice

    Mix, apply, and let it sit for 5 minutes. Rinse off for a berry-infused glow!

  5. Nourishing Cherry & Peach Mask for Dry Skin:
    • 8-9 cherries
    • 1 ripe peach
    • 1 teaspoon extra-virgin olive oil

    Blend it, apply it for 20 minutes, and say hello to velvety-smooth skin.

  6. Egg White & Cherry Face Mask for Oily Skin:
    • 1 egg white
    • 2 tablespoons cornmeal
    • 1 tablespoon honey
    • 10 mashed cherries

    Beat it, mix it, apply it for 20 minutes, and wash away the excess oil. Goodbye, greasy skin!
